Privacy-Preserving Verification of Aggregate Queries on Outsourced Databases
نویسندگان
چکیده
It is often desirable to be able to guarantee the integrity of historical data, ensuring that any subsequent modifications to the data can be detected. It would be especially convenient to extend such proofs of integrity to certain computations performed later using the historic data. We approach this question in the context of outsourced databases, where a data owner delegates the ability to answer users’ queries to a service provider, and distrustful users may desire to verify the integrity of responses to their queries on the data. We present a solution for integrity verification of database aggregate queries, such as SUM and MAX. We design proofs of correctness and completeness of aggregate results. What makes the problem challenging is that individual data entries may be sensitive (e.g. as in medical databases), and should not be revealed to the user. We give cryptographic protocols to support verification of query results in a privacy-preserving fashion.
منابع مشابه
Privacy-Preserving Computation and Verification of Aggregate Queries on Outsourced Databases
Outsourced databases provide a solution for data owners who want to delegate the task of answering database queries to third-party service providers. However, distrustful users may desire a means of verifying the integrity of responses to their database queries. Simultaneously, for privacy or security reasons, the data owner may want to keep the database hidden from service providers. This secu...
متن کاملPrivacy-Preserving Verification of Aggregate Queries on Outsourced Database
It is often desirable to be able to guarantee the integrity of historical data, ensuring that any subsequent modifications to the data can be detected. It would be especially convenient to extend such proofs of integrity to certain computations performed later using the historic data. We approach this question in the context of outsourced databases, where a data owner delegates the ability to a...
متن کاملAccess Control Friendly Query Verification for Outsourced Data Publishing
Outsourced data publishing is a promising approach to achieve higher distribution efficiency, greater data survivability, and lower management cost. In outsourced data publishing (sometimes referred to as third-party publishing), a data owner gives the content of databases to multiple publishers which answer queries sent by clients. In many cases, the trustworthiness of the publishers cannot be...
متن کاملA Method for Protecting Access Pattern in Outsourced Data
Protecting the information access pattern, which means preventing the disclosure of data and structural details of databases, is very important in working with data, especially in the cases of outsourced databases and databases with Internet access. The protection of the information access pattern indicates that mere data confidentiality is not sufficient and the privacy of queries and accesses...
متن کاملPrivacy-Aware Verification of Aggregate Queries on Outsourced Databases with Applications to Historic Data Integrity
It is often desirable to be able to guarantee the integrity of historical data, ensuring that any subsequent modifications to the data can be detected. It would be especially convenient to extend such proofs of integrity to certain computations performed later using the historic data. We raise this question in the context of outsourced databases, where a data owner delegates the ability to answ...
متن کامل